    If you only have a relatively small number of items, The time spent labelling up and printing the bar codes may make a scanner a waste of time, instead consider a tablet or mobile phone with a copy of excel on it, then you just count the stock and enter it into the tablet for transfer to accounts software

    i was at Zebra thu night with some kids i was mentoring for a business challenge.

    They (and therefor I) got shown around their innovation centre. The demo'd a shop display of multiple goods that they did a stock take of in about 10 seconds by waving a scanner around (was between 3 and 4 hundred individual items) BUT they pointed out it was only practical for high end goods as the rfid labels needed for that type of labelling/scanning are still not cheap when you take into account having to attach them - they said current usage is places like higher end clothes shops where each item has decent value
